Research On Spatial Morphology Cognition Of Underground Street Intersection Based On Virtual Reality

At present,many cities have begun to develop urban underground space.The large-scale underground pedestrian system has begun to take shape.The underground intersection space serves as an important node of the underground street and carries a large number of people.However,due to the lack of natural factors and poor air circulation,there are widespread problems such as closed depression in underground streets.How to improve the space experience of underground streets has become an urgent problem to be solved.The variety of spatial forms of the intersection gives people a different feeling,which is one of the important factors that affect the experience and cognition of the underground street.Now there are few studies on the spatial and cognition of underground intersections at home and abroad,and the research perspective is relatively simple.Based on the three levels of spatial cognition,this thesis explores the correlation between spatial morphology and spatial cognition at the intersection of underground streets,and provides theoretical basis for the design and optimization of underground intersections through the cognition experiment.This study combines investigation and online research to collect data from a total of 112 intersections and construct 9 representative virtual experiment scenarios.The questionnaire is used to quantify the data of spatial cognition.For finding the differences and cognitive rules of spatial cognition in different intersections,this study analyzes the influence of each element on the spatial cognition of intersections with the statistical methods.The conclusion can provide a feasible strategy for intersection space design.Based on the three levels of spatial cognition,this study divides the spatial morphology cognition of underground intersection into three parts: “path selection”,“scene perception” and “cognitive map”.First,the study explores the impact of spatial patterns at the intersection on pedestrian routing.In the experiment,the tendency of path selection in each scene was collected in the form of scene task.It was found that chamfering in the corner of underground intersection has a positive guiding effect on pedestrian path selection.The obtuse angles produced by the oblique intersection of the streets have a positive guiding effect on the path selection,and the acute angle is opposite.Secondly,the study explores the correlation between the components of the intersection and the spatial experience.Based on the above study,the "corner processing" has a great influence on the spatial experience.The degree of corner processing is positively correlated with the spatial experience;the "intersection method" and the "street position relationship" have the relatively low impact on the intersection experience,and the “street misalignment relationship” has a small degree of negative impact.Thirdly,the study explores cognitive patterns of intersections by cognitive maps.The results show that the spatial image constructed in the brain is related to the sequence of the trails;the cognitive levels of each element and each level are different,and the "corner processing" has the highest recognition and the most acceptable;the establishment of spatial imagery has a tendency to "positive intersection" and "alignment relationship".The above three experimental results complement each other and confirm each other.This study summarizes the spatial cognition of intersections,and attempts to propose design suggestions and optimization strategies for practical applications.The content of this study is based on the actual situation of underground streets,and has practical significance.The research conclusions have perfected and referenced the research on the intersection space of domestic underground streets,which has certain theoretical significance;the research conclusions on the design of underground space nodes and other similar spaces Cognitive research has a certain reference role and has a strong promotion significance.
